A MOTORIST had to be rescued after the vehicle he was driving became stranded at Shell Ford near Himbleton.
The 4×4 was caught out by the fast-flowing water which was 3ft deep around the time of the incident which took place at 3.05pm on Saturday afternoon (January 3).
Firefighters from Droitwich and Pershore were sent to the scene and an inflatable rescue boat was used to get the driver and vehicle to safety.
The situation was resolved by 3.30pm and firefighters left the scene just after 4pm.
